Dry Hydrotherapy on the Go Printer Friendly Version
A while ago I was relaxing in a whirlpool and, while massaging my mussels and joints, I wondered what key components might be used in constructing a portable/wearable device that could simulate the same feeling as a jet stream. My list if items consisted of:
- small & durable motor w/ vibration and voltage control (smooth dimmer style preferred) with a single steel rotating shaft.

- battery and solar back up with plug-in adapter.

- heat control unit wired into the motor.

- One plastic ball deeply dimpled with round tips (maybe magnetic).

- light-weight plastic housing and comfortable harness with straps (Velcro).

- ball area cover material must be thin/strong, sterile, soft and warm i.e. (silk).

- user friendly.

MedWiki Printer Friendly Version
A website where medical researchers, practitioners (aka doctors) and the public share news and insights on latest happenings on the world of medicine.
Researchers and doctors share their research findings and add information on diseases and treatment options. The content would be reviewed and updated, similar to the wikipedia-style, by fellow researchers and doctors who would gain by publicizing their work and speciality.
The public can get the latest research findings in simple, comprehensible language direct from the research world. For example, they can get information on the efficacy, side effects, etc. of new drugs, to treat hypertension from MedWiki through rss feeds or e-mail alerts.
A win-win partnership created for all three parties - researchers, doctors and public. Are you excited by the idea or is it already out there? I am pretty close to launching the site but I want to know what other people think of it. I sincerely welcome your suggestions and thoughts.

Korean vs Western dining table Printer Friendly Version
Having a table that can change height after what is wanted/ needed, from a Korean dining table to Western dining table. Also, it should be able to change the height of only half of the table, so half can be Korean traditional style and half Western.

A table like this would be very convenient for non-Koreans living in Korea together with a Korean, or a Korean living abroad with a westerner.
